Case Notes
This is a tummy tuck case performed on a 63-year-old woman. The before photo shows loose, crepey abdominal skin with significant wrinkling across the lower and mid-abdomen, along with surgical planning marks visible on the skin. Six months after surgery, the abdomen is noticeably flatter and the skin surface is smooth. The low horizontal scar, still maturing at this point, sits along the bikini line where it can be covered by underwear or swimwear. The navel position looks centered and sits cleanly against the abdominal wall.
